Signed-off-by: Nigel Cunningham kernel/power/proc.c | 133 +++++++++++++++++++++++++++++++++++++++++++++++++++ 1 files changed, 133 insertions(+), 0 deletions(-) diff --git a/kernel/power/proc.c b/kernel/power/proc.c index e072b50..cdbf9cf 100644 --- a/kernel/power/proc.c +++ b/kernel/power/proc.c @@ -98,3 +98,136 @@ static int suspend_read_proc(char *page, return len; } +/* suspend_write_proc + * + * Generic routine for handling writing to files representing + * bits, integers and unsigned longs. + */ + +static int suspend_write_proc(struct file *file, const char *buffer, + unsigned long count, void *data) +{ + struct suspend_proc_data *proc_data = (struct suspend_proc_data *) data; + char *my_buf = (char *) get_zeroed_page(GFP_ATOMIC); + int result = count, assigned_temp_buffer = 0; + + if (!my_buf) + return -ENOMEM; + + if (count > PAGE_SIZE) + count = PAGE_SIZE; + + if (copy_from_user(my_buf, buffer, count)) + return -EFAULT; + + if (suspend_start_anything(proc_data == &proc_params[0])) + return -EBUSY; + + my_buf[count] = 0; + + if (proc_data->needs_storage_manager & 2) + suspend_prepare_usm(); + + switch (proc_data->type) { + case SUSPEND_PROC_DATA_CUSTOM: + if (proc_data->data.special.write_proc) { + write_proc_t *write_proc = proc_data->data.special.write_proc; + result = write_proc(file, buffer, count, data); + } + break; + case SUSPEND_PROC_DATA_BIT: + { + int value = simple_strtoul(my_buf, NULL, 0); + if (value) + set_bit(proc_data->data.bit.bit, + (proc_data->data.bit.bit_vector)); + else + clear_bit(proc_data->data.bit.bit, + (proc_data->data.bit.bit_vector)); + } + break; + case SUSPEND_PROC_DATA_INTEGER: + { + int *variable = proc_data->data.integer.variable; + int minimum = proc_data->data.integer.minimum; + int maximum = proc_data->data.integer.maximum; + *variable = simple_strtol(my_buf, NULL, 0); + + if (maximum && ((*variable) < minimum)) + *variable = minimum; + + if (maximum && ((*variable) > maximum)) + *variable = maximum; + break; + } + case SUSPEND_PROC_DATA_LONG: + { + long *variable = proc_data->data.a_long.variable; + long minimum = proc_data->data.a_long.minimum; + long maximum = proc_data->data.a_long.maximum; + *variable = simple_strtol(my_buf, NULL, 0); + + if (maximum && ((*variable) < minimum)) + *variable = minimum; + + if (maximum && ((*variable) > maximum)) + *variable = maximum; + break; + } + case SUSPEND_PROC_DATA_UL: + { + unsigned long *variable = proc_data->data.ul.variable; + unsigned long minimum = proc_data->data.ul.minimum; + unsigned long maximum = proc_data->data.ul.maximum; + *variable = simple_strtoul(my_buf, NULL, 0); + + if (maximum && ((*variable) < minimum)) + *variable = minimum; + + if (maximum && ((*variable) > maximum)) + *variable = maximum; + break; + } + break; + case SUSPEND_PROC_DATA_STRING: + { + int copy_len = count; + char *variable = + proc_data->data.string.variable; + + if (proc_data->data.string.max_length && + (copy_len > proc_data->data.string.max_length)) + copy_len = proc_data->data.string.max_length; + + if (!variable) { + proc_data->data.string.variable = + variable = (char *) get_zeroed_page(GFP_ATOMIC); + assigned_temp_buffer = 1; + } + strncpy(variable, my_buf, copy_len); + if ((copy_len) && + (my_buf[copy_len - 1] == '\n')) + variable[count - 1] = 0; + variable[count] = 0; + } + break; + } + free_page((unsigned long) my_buf); + /* Side effect routine? */ + if (proc_data->write_proc) + proc_data->write_proc(); + + /* Free temporary buffers */ + if (assigned_temp_buffer) { + free_page((unsigned long) proc_data->data.string.variable); + proc_data->data.string.variable = NULL; + } + + if (proc_data->needs_storage_manager & 2) + suspend_cleanup_usm(); + + suspend_finish_anything(proc_data == &proc_params[0]); + + return result; +} + -- Nigel Cunningham nigel at suspend2 dot net
